#President Tinubu Directs Security Agencies to Rescue Kidnapped Schoolchildren in Kaduna.

President Bola Ahmed Tinubu has issued a directive to security agencies to undertake all necessary measures to rescue the 287 kidnapped schoolchildren in Kuriga, Chikun Local Government Area of Kaduna State. Vice President Senator Kashim Shettima conveyed this message during a sympathy visit to Kaduna State Government, emphasizing the urgency of leaving no stone unturned until the children are safely returned to their parents.

During a closed-door meeting with Kuriga community leaders, parents of the abducted children, security chiefs, and state government officials, Vice President Shettima also urged media caution in reporting to safeguard the security of the kidnapped children, highlighting the paramount importance of government’s responsibility to protect citizens’ lives and property.

He assured that President Tinubu is fully committed to addressing the situation, having instructed security agencies to prioritize the safe return of the abducted children. Governor Uba Sani, while expressing gratitude for the Vice President’s visit, reiterated the government’s determination to collaborate with security agencies and the community to ensure the children’s safe return, urging the media to exercise discretion in their reporting to avoid endangering the lives of the children.
